Transaction ec76e53faa5a06b377a451a98cc4cd9f6da09d6e538444fae78298694b003a33
1 Input
1 Output
-
ec76e53faa5a06b377a451a98cc4cd9f6da09d6e538444fae78298694b003a33:0
- value
- 102300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9c97798dfaa42efa7b2d8d47b601b2af3a85167 OP_EQUAL
- address
- 3QTmXVdFMw1TDWxXGYEhWwuA6CR7MhvksE